97 SIERRA 5.0 4X4
When it's cold and after or during cornering, it sounds like
my belt is squealing (LOUDLY). The belt seems tight enough
and appears to be in reasonable condition. I'm wondering
why it would do this only when and after turning the wheel.
I was looking into replacing it and I saw you need to loosen
the tension pully, but didn't say how. I see a nut on the pully
I thought I'd throw it out there before I start wrenching on things.

The tensioner has a square hole in it for a 3/8 ratchet for relieving tension. More than likely this tensioner has siezed in place and is not working correctly. If you take the tension off the belt(without loosening anything) and the tensioner doesn't spring back. Then change the belt and the tensioner.

I would agree the tensioner. how old is the belt, is it glased this will also let it slip. start the engine and take a look at the belt is it running smothly then have someone turn the wheel see if the belt starts to bounce around if it does its the tensioner
